The Project

The project is simple. Write the maker of a product every day for a year. Do not ask them specifically for coupons as I did in the Coupon Mania post. Do not write regarding any particular product more than twice in a year. Do not write any particular parent company more than four time is a month (or once a week). Be honest in what you write, give feed back, ask questions. (NOTE: While I have these categorized by parent company, I never wrote to any parent company more than one time in a day.)
